The alternative to a commodity money system is fiat money which is defined by a central bank and government law as legal tender even if it has no intrinsic value. Originally fiat money was paper currency or base metal coinage, but in modern economies it mainly exists as data such as bank balances and records of credit or debit card purchases, [3] and the fraction that exists as notes and coins ...

Early money consisted of commodities; the oldest being in the form of cattle and the most widely used being cowrie shells. [459] Money has since evolved into governmental issued coins, paper and electronic money. Legal tender, or narrow money (M0) is the cash created by a Central Bank by minting coins and printing banknotes. Bank money, or broad money (M1/M2) is the money created by private banks through the recording of loans as deposits of borrowing clients, with partial support indicated by the cash ratio. Whether the ruble or the dollar is used in the economic system, the criterion of a price system is the use of money as an arbiter and usual final arbiter of whether a thing is done or not. In other words, few things are done without consideration for the monetary costs and the potential making of a profit in a price system.
